By Collin de Plancy (Translated by Prudence Priest)
Seattle: Trident Books, 1999. Cloth. Near Fine/Very Good +. Louis Breton. A handsome copy of the 1999 numbered, limited edition. #243 OF ONLY 1,000 COPIES ISSUED. Tight and Near Fine to Fine in a crisp, VG+ dustjacket, with very light creasing --and just a touch of soiling-- along the panel edges. Octavo, fold-out frontispiece, 69 high-quality engraved illustrations by Louis Breton. "Being a complete collection of the diabolic portraiture designed by Louis Breton for J.A.S. Collin de Plancy's 'Dictionnaire Infernal', depicting many of the demons & dignitaries named in the classic literature of medieval magic and sorcery. Presented with a translation of the descriptions of the demons from the original French text, rendered by Prudence Priest" (from the title page).
